The Unique Needs Of Curly Hair Scalps

Curly hair is naturally drier than other hair types. This happens because the natural oils from the scalp, called sebum, struggle to move along the twists of the hair. So, curly scalps need extra moisture.

Also, the curl shape can trap dirt and product buildup more easily. This can cause scalp irritation if it isn’t cleaned well. But, using harsh shampoos can wash away essential oils from the scalp and hair, making dryness worse.

So, it’s important to keep a balance. Gentle washing can remove buildup. Deep hydration can help bring back moisture and keep the scalp healthy.

Common Scalp Issues Among Curly Hair Types

Navigating curly hair care can bring unique challenges for your scalp. Here are some common problems people with curly hair face:

  • Dryness and Itchiness: When the scalp cannot keep moisture, it leads to dryness and itchiness.
  • Scalp Irritation: Using harsh products or having too much buildup can irritate sensitive scalp skin.
  • Dandruff: This common issue, which shows up as white flakes, is often more frequent among those with curly hair.

To solve these problems, it’s important to understand their causes first. This helps in creating a scalp care routine that fits your needs.

Hydrating Treatments For Scalp Nourishment

Hydrating treatments are very important to add moisture and keep your scalp healthy, especially if you have dry, curly hair. These treatments provide much more moisture than a usual conditioner because they focus on your scalp.

Try to add a weekly oiling session for your scalp. Good natural oils to use are jojoba oil, argan oil, and coconut oil. They give deep moisture and nutrients. Just massage a little oil onto your scalp. Then leave it on for a few hours or overnight before you wash your hair.

If you want something stronger, look for hair masks meant for the scalp. These masks have special ingredients that attract and keep moisture. They will make your scalp feel clean and refreshed.

Gentle Cleansing Techniques To Avoid Scalp Irritation

Keeping your scalp moist is very important, but it’s also key to keep it clean. For curly hair, you need to cleanse it gently so it doesn’t lose its natural oils.

First, always pick a sulfate-free shampoo made for curly hair. These shampoos clean really well without being too harsh. When you wash your hair, use your fingertips to massage the shampoo into your scalp. Make small, gentle circles.

Don’t scrub or use your nails, as this can irritate your scalp. Rinse your hair well to make sure there’s no leftover product.

Nutrients That Boost Scalp And Hair Health

Incorporating certain nutrients into your diet can significantly impact the health of your scalp and hair. Here’s a breakdown of key nutrients and their benefits:

A diet rich in vitamins, minerals, and protein can help strengthen hair follicles, promote growth, and combat common scalp issues. By nourishing your body from within, you can support healthy hair growth and achieve a vibrant, thriving mane.

NutrientBenefitsFood Sources
BiotinPromotes hair growth, strengthens hair strandsEggs, nuts, seeds
ZincAids in cell reproduction and tissue growth, essential for scalp healthOysters, pumpkin seeds, chickpeas
IronCarries oxygen to hair follicles, promoting growthRed meat, spinach, lentils
Vitamin CHelps in collagen production, essential for hair structureCitrus fruits, bell peppers
Omega-3 Fatty AcidsReduces inflammation, promotes scalp healthSalmon, walnuts, flaxseeds

The Importance Of Water Intake For A Healthy Scalp

When you want a healthy scalp and shiny hair, it’s important to stay hydrated. Drinking enough water every day helps keep your scalp in good shape. Drinking enough water also helps control the scalp’s oil levels. This can stop your scalp from getting too dry or too oily. Keeping this balance is very important for a healthy scalp.

Also, drinking enough water helps blood flow to the scalp. This blood flow gives the hair follicles the nutrients they need to grow strong. Try to drink at least eight glasses of water each day for a healthy scalp and beautiful hair.
